01.09.2022
UN chief plans to name former Senegalese minister as Libya envoy

[…] The 15-member UN Security Council needs to agree by consensus to the appointment of Abdoulaye Bathily as the UN special envoy for Libya. … Bathily would replace Jan Kubis, who stepped down in December. Guterres had informally proposed two other people to fill the role, but the Security Council could not agree.

28.08.2022
Libya's Tripoli quiet after worst fighting in two years

Libya's capital was quiet early Sunday, a day after the worst fighting there for two years killed 32 people and injured 159 as forces aligned with a parliament-backed administration failed to dislodge the Tripoli-based government.

25.07.2022
Human rights abuses, political stalemates, electoral delays mar progress

The overall situation in Libya remains “highly volatile”, Martha Pobee, UN Assistant Secretary-General for political affairs and peace operations, told the Security Council on Monday. Despite some progress, a constitutional and political stalemate continues, prolonging tensions and fuelling insecurity, while clashes in and around Tripoli surge, she added.
